What is involved in taking tank out.
Remove trunk lining and undo nuts holding the tank on. From below, remove the fuel lines at the tank and push the tank grommet into the trunk area. Pull on it from the passenger side to start to remove it. I can't remember where it is on a W116 but you'll have to also remove the sending unit plug.

Fairly straightforward, I think it's mostly 17mm and 19mm for the hose connections on the bottom.
